Output 660f732193c5e35a273a03a39b6f4fe2c3192e6c0c7b0164fc80918b878bbd33:0

value
27798081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c648c93818682dac3ae33089d08d588a55a955a6 OP_EQUAL
address
MRybDg1Zk4cUeauuo41KQWiRzZoYJhDrNx
transaction
660f732193c5e35a273a03a39b6f4fe2c3192e6c0c7b0164fc80918b878bbd33
spent
true